How To Fix JBA_US_GENERAL101 - Posting date &1 is holiday and shifted to the previous business day &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: JBA_US_GENERAL - ALM: General error messages for US analytical banking

  • Message number: 101

  • Message text: Posting date &1 is holiday and shifted to the previous business day &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message JBA_US_GENERAL101 - Posting date &1 is holiday and shifted to the previous business day &2 ?

    The SAP error message JBA_US_GENERAL101 indicates that the posting date you are trying to use falls on a holiday, and as a result, the system has automatically shifted the posting date to the previous business day. This is a common occurrence in systems that account for holidays and non-working days in financial transactions.

    Cause:

    1. Holiday Configuration: The posting date you selected is recognized as a holiday in the system's calendar settings. This could be due to local holidays, company-specific holidays, or national holidays.
    2. Business Calendar Settings: The business calendar may not include the date you are trying to post, leading to the system's automatic adjustment to the previous business day.

    Solution:

    1. Check Posting Date: Verify the posting date you are trying to use. If it is indeed a holiday, consider using a different date that is a valid business day.
    2. Review Holiday Calendar: Check the holiday calendar settings in your SAP system. You can do this by navigating to:
      • Transaction Code: SCAL (for maintaining the calendar)
      • Transaction Code: OVK1 (for viewing and maintaining holiday calendars)
      • Ensure that the holiday settings are correct and reflect the actual holidays for your organization.
    3. Adjust Posting Date: If you need to post on a specific date that is a holiday, you may need to adjust your business processes or seek approval for exceptions, if applicable.
    4. Consult with SAP Basis or Configuration Team: If you believe the holiday settings are incorrect or need adjustments, consult with your SAP Basis or configuration team to ensure that the holiday calendar is set up correctly.
